3 definitions found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Endozoa \En`do*zo"a\ ([e^]n`d[-o]*z[=o]"[.a]), n. pl. [NL., fr. Gr. 'e`ndon within + zw^,on an animal.] (Zo["o]l.) See {Entozoa}. [1913 Webster] From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: endozoa See {endozoan} From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: endozoan adj : of or relating to entozoa [syn: {entozoan}] n : any of various parasites that live in the internal organs of animals (especially intestinal worms) [syn: {endoparasite}, {entoparasite}, {entozoan}, {entozoon}] [also: {endozoa} (pl)]
